The following changes are on my mind for 9.0, and some others.  I will do
many; others I'm a reviewer for a contributor. I think these are best done
on a major release, but this isn't to say each is "important".  Jan (as
RM), please let me know what you think.  I suppose I need your approval?

Observability:
* https://issues.apache.org/jira/browse/SOLR-14686 Remove log "[coreName]"
(logid) which is redundant with MDC
-- PR just updated and tagged some possible reviewers.  No feedback yet :-/
 I'll merge soon.
* https://issues.apache.org/jira/browse/SOLR-15905 "Don't automatically
register Solr's metrics with JMX (SolrJmxReporter)"
-- Yet our default solr.xml could keep it?.  ETA Jan 24
* https://issues.apache.org/jira/browse/SOLR-14401 ""distrib" request
handler metrics should only be tracked on pertinent handlers"
-- Looking for some feedback on the issue first.  ETA Jan 24

Highlighting:
* https://issues.apache.org/jira/browse/SOLR-15259 lower default
hl.fragAlignRatio
-- minor change but better to change highlighting fragment defaults in a
major release but not critical.  ETA: Jan 17
* https://issues.apache.org/jira/browse/SOLR-12901 Make UnifiedHighlighter
the default
-- There are some overlaps between the highlighters but I definitely think
the UH is the best highlighter.  ETA Jan 21
-- separate issue, TBD: removing the big/verbose configs for the other
highlighters from the default solrconfig.xml to keep it leaner.

Docker:
* JIRA TBD, Java 17 runtime.  ETA Jan 17

Filter.java; remove/hide
* https://issues.apache.org/jira/browse/SOLR-12336 "Remove Filter from Solr"
-- a contributor has something but is getting approval.  If we don't get
this in time, I could do something simple to just ensure the class isn't
public.

Nested Docs:
* https://issues.apache.org/jira/browse/SOLR-15064 "Atomic/partial updates
to nested docs should not assume _route_ param is the root ID"
-- Debt/confusion to be removed. ETA 21 Jan

Modularizing:
* Solrj-Zookeeper: ETA Jan 17
* https://issues.apache.org/jira/browse/SOLR-14660  HDFS (or Hadoop?)
-- Waiting for the contributor to return to it.  See the issue for
discussion on what to do if it stagnates further.

~ David Smiley
Apache Lucene/Solr Search Developer
http://www.linkedin.com/in/davidwsmiley

Reply via email to